Wrexham’s new Chopstix Noodle Bar giving 100 free meals to customers at its grand opening

A new Pan-Asian noodle bar will open its doors in Wrexham this week – with the first 100 customers set to receive free food.

Chopstix, based on 40 – 42 Regent Street, is inviting hungry locals to click their sticks and ‘wok’ this way to sample some of their much loved dishes.

Opening on Thursday 15 June, customers will be able to delight in a host of Pan-Asian flavours including their newest dish, the limited edition Zesty Lemon Chicken, their bestselling Salt ‘N’ Pepper Chicken, as well as Chopstix favourites including Chicken Katsu Curry and the signature Caramel Drizzle Chicken.

To announce their arrival in Wrexham with fanfare the store will be giving away 100 free small boxes with any topping to the first 100 people in line.

Rob Burns, Marketing Director for Chopstix, said: “Wrexham has been firmly put on the map in recent months and we are excited to finally open our doors here.

“The team are looking forward to welcoming locals and showing them what Chopstix has to offer.

“Whether dining in or grabbing ‘to go’ to enjoy in the glorious sunshine we aim to offer something to entice everyone.”

The new Chopstix store is just the latest in the expansion plans of the group with more store launches to be announced in the upcoming months.

The noodle bar’s popular dishes are also available to order from Uber Eats, Deliveroo and Just Eat.

Orders are permitted from within the postcode area of the store.
